What is the difference between Weekend Embedded Systems vs Weekend Software Developer?

AspectWeekend Embedded SystemsWeekend Software Developer
Required SkillsEmbedded programming, C/C++, hardware integrationApplication development, Java, Python, UI design
Work EnvironmentHardware labs, manufacturing settings, technical projectsOffice, remote, software development teams
CertificationsEmbedded systems certifications, hardware designSoftware certifications, programming courses
Industry UsageElectronics, automotive, IoTWeb, mobile apps, enterprise software

Weekend Embedded Systems roles focus on hardware and embedded programming, often in technical environments, while Weekend Software Developers work primarily on application and software development tasks. Both roles may require specific certifications and are used across different industry sectors, but they share overlapping skills in programming and problem-solving.

Some highlights of this opportunity include:
• Participate in the decision-making process in relation to admission to hospice at home or in the inpatient setting
• Participating as a member of the Interdisciplinary Team in the development of individualized care plans
• Certify (re-certify when necessary) patients eligible for hospice care under the Medicare Hospice Benefit
• Consult with attending physicians regarding pain and symptom management
• Coordinate efforts with the attending physician to provide continuity of care
• Develop and monitor the medical component of the hospice program
• Participate in the development, coordination and implementation of hospice services and policies
• Participating in the development of staff and volunteer training
• Conduct home visits (in person and virtual) as a consulting physician when appropriate
• Act as a hospice liaison and advocate with the national, state and local physicians, healthcare professionals, partners and community
• Perform related administrative functions as required and/or assigned
• Schedule: Forty-eight (48) on call weeks per year: Monday 7am through Friday 7pm. Including mandatory in person attendance of 1 Inter Disciplinary Team Meeting (IDT) per week. Four (4) weekends per year: Friday 7pm through Monday 7am
